[ID:2781] From: Mr Alexander Kelly / To: Dr William Cullen (Professor Cullen) / Regarding: Mr Sharp jnr. (Patient) / 30 March 1786 / (Incoming)

Letter from Alexander Kells, concerning the case of Mr Sharp's son. Kells reports that 'the sore on his groine still continuees to look cleaner & better from the application of the precipitate according to your directions to bring down the fungus'.
